An award-winning international law firm in London is seeking a talented Senior Corporate Lawyer or Partner to join its highly regarded team. The role offers significant client exposure, early responsibility, and the opportunity to work on complex domestic and cross-border transactions.
The ideal candidate will have over 5 years PQE in corporate/M&A, be confident in managing client relationships, and have a keen interest in business development. Join a high-performing environment that values collaboration and career growth.

How to prepare for a job interview at IDEX Consulting Ltd
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your corporate law knowledge, especially around M&A and private equity. Be prepared to discuss recent cases or transactions you've worked on, as well as any relevant legislation that could impact the role.
✨Showcase Your Client Management Skills
Since the role involves significant client exposure, think of examples where you've successfully managed client relationships. Be ready to explain how you handle difficult situations and maintain strong connections with clients.
✨Demonstrate Business Development Acumen
This firm values business development, so come armed with ideas on how you can contribute. Think about strategies you've used in the past to attract new clients or expand existing relationships, and be ready to share them.
✨Emphasise Collaboration
The environment is high-performing and collaborative, so highlight your teamwork skills. Share examples of how you've worked effectively within a team, particularly on complex transactions, and how you contribute to a positive team dynamic.
